import redis.asyncio as aredis
from settings import REDIS_URL
import logging
logger = logging.getLogger("[services.redis] ")
logger.setLevel(logging.DEBUG)
class RedisCache:
def __init__(self, uri=REDIS_URL):
self._uri: str = uri
self.pubsub_channels = []
self._client = None
async def connect(self):
self._client = aredis.Redis.from_url(self._uri, decode_responses=True)
async def disconnect(self):
if self._client:
await self._client.close()
async def execute(self, command, *args, **kwargs):
if self._client:
try:
logger.debug(f"{command} {args} {kwargs}")
r = await self._client.execute_command(command, *args, **kwargs)
logger.debug(type(r))
logger.debug(r)
return r
except Exception as e:
logger.error(e)
async def subscribe(self, *channels):
if self._client:
async with self._client.pubsub() as pubsub:
for channel in channels:
await pubsub.subscribe(channel)
self.pubsub_channels.append(channel)
async def unsubscribe(self, *channels):
if not self._client:
return
async with self._client.pubsub() as pubsub:
for channel in channels:
await pubsub.unsubscribe(channel)
self.pubsub_channels.remove(channel)
async def publish(self, channel, data):
if not self._client:
return
await self._client.publish(channel, data)
redis = RedisCache()
__all__ = ["redis"]
